About

SHADOWS was composed in 2011 as a commission for pianist Jeffrey Biegel and an international consortium of orchestras, anchored by the Louisiana Philharmonic. Zwilich wrote: "As people have migrated from their homelands to new lands for many centuries, taking with them 'shadows' of their homeland, this new composition will reflect the migration of the human spirit, in musical form, from continent to continent. Shadows of family life, religion, language, cultural roots bind us together as one world. Joining orchestras worldwide in musical diplomacy is the project mission, and the title of the work is one which we can all relate to in some way." During the quarantine of 2020, Zwilich created this new chamber version to facilitate performance with small chamber ensembles.
